From 3698f68ae99058991919e7b24cda8017f53da991 Mon Sep 17 00:00:00 2001 From: ForeverHYX <2937532336@qq.com> Date: Sat, 8 Aug 2026 16:05:22 +0800 Subject: [PATCH] rtl: keep buffered KMU launches busy The KMU clears running after the final CTA enters a registered fanout. Downstream busy can take another cycle to propagate, so device busy can briefly fall and make the host report completion while the launch remains buffered. Expose pending from VX_kmu_arb and include it in the busy aggregation at every hierarchy level.
